PDA

View Full Version : media print



olampiad
جمعه 03 آبان 1392, 21:06 عصر
سلام
منظور اصلی از این جمله چیست؟
نمای چاپ باید ساختار یافته ، خوانا و اقتصادی باشد. (در مصرف کاغذ صرفه جویی کند)
آیا امکانش هست که کاری کنیم در نمای پرینت ساختار سایت به طور کلی عوض شود.
مثلا width افزایش یابد.
ممنون

tooka123
شنبه 04 آبان 1392, 13:47 عصر
باید چندتا فایل css درست کنی.

برای تعیین CSS صفحه در حالت عادی که همان نمایش صفحه در مرورگر است ، بصورت زیر فایل CSS را در فایل HTML خود لینک میکنیم :

<link href=”styles.css” rel=”stylesheet” type=”text/css” media=”all” />
اگر بخواهیم به ازای هر رسانه (مانند مرورگر ، دستگاه های PDA و پرینترها) فایل های استایل متفاوتی استفاده شوند باید از کدهای زیر استفاده کنید
برای نمایش توسط مرورگر :

<link href=”styles1.css” rel=”stylesheet” type=”text/css” media=”screen” />
برای نمایش هنگام پرینت کردن صفحه :

<link href=”styles2.css” rel=”stylesheet” type=”text/css” media=”print” />
برای نمایش صفحه در انواع PDA :

<link href=”styles3.css” rel=”stylesheet” type=”text/css” media=”handheld” />

olampiad
یک شنبه 05 آبان 1392, 00:05 صبح
حالا چه کاری انجا م دهم که تو نمای پرینت صفحه اقتضادی باشد
تو فونت چه تغیراتی انجام دهم.
بی نهایت ممنون

tooka123
یک شنبه 05 آبان 1392, 09:16 صبح
منظورتون از اقتصادی چیه ؟ برای تغییر فونت باید در فایل مربوط به پرینت واسه body یا هر idو کلاس فونت موردنظرت رومشخص کنی


body{
font-family:tahoma,....;
}

هر تعداد فونت بخواهی می تونی تعریف کنی که اگر فونت اول موجود نبود فونت بعدی اعمال می شه.